Skip to content

Commit fa4fdb9

Browse files
authored
Pin protobuf, a dependency for skein, to workaround issue in skein (#880)
1 parent d565966 commit fa4fdb9

File tree

1 file changed

+15
-2
lines changed

1 file changed

+15
-2
lines changed

dask-gateway-server/pyproject.toml

Lines changed: 15 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-47,9 +47,22 @@ kerberos = [
4747
]
4848
jobqueue = ["sqlalchemy>=2.0.0"]
4949
local = ["sqlalchemy>=2.0.0"]
50-
yarn = ["sqlalchemy>=2.0.0", "skein >= 0.7.3"]
50+
yarn = [
51+
"sqlalchemy>=2.0.0",
52+
"skein>=0.7.3",
53+
# FIXME: protobuf is a dependency for skein, and is being held back here for
54+
# now due to a error description reported in
55+
# https://github.com/jcrist/skein/issues/255
56+
#
57+
"protobuf<3.21",
58+
]
5159
kubernetes = ["kubernetes_asyncio"]
52-
all_backends = ["sqlalchemy>=2.0.0", "skein >= 0.7.3", "kubernetes_asyncio"]
60+
all_backends = [
61+
"sqlalchemy>=2.0.0",
62+
"skein>=0.7.3",
63+
"protobuf<3.21",
64+
"kubernetes_asyncio",
65+
]
5366

5467
[project.urls]
5568
Documentation = "https://gateway.dask.org/"

0 commit comments

Comments
 (0)